编程进阶:精选语言·巧用函数·高效变量
|
编程进阶的核心在于对语言特性的深度理解。选择一门适合当前任务的语言,是迈向高效开发的第一步。例如,若需处理大量数据,Python 的简洁语法与丰富的库能显著提升效率;若追求极致性能,C++ 或 Rust 则更合适。掌握语言的底层机制,如内存管理、类型系统和并发模型,能让代码不仅运行更快,也更稳定可靠。 函数是程序的基石,但如何使用它决定了代码的可读性与复用性。避免编写过长的函数,将逻辑拆分为小而专注的单元,每个函数只做一件事。命名要清晰准确,如 `calculate_total_price` 比 `calc` 更具表达力。善用高阶函数,如 map、filter、reduce,能以声明式方式简化复杂操作,使代码更接近自然语言思维。 变量的使用同样需要讲究策略。避免全局变量泛滥,它们容易引发副作用和难以追踪的错误。尽量在最小作用域内定义变量,使用 `let` 或 `const`(在支持的语言中)明确其可变性。合理使用解构赋值,如从对象或数组中提取所需字段,让代码更紧凑且意图明确。同时,避免重复计算,将中间结果缓存到变量中,减少冗余运算。
此图AI模拟,仅供参考 进阶不是堆砌复杂语法,而是追求“清晰”与“高效”的平衡。通过精选语言、巧用函数、合理管理变量,代码将不再是机械的指令集合,而成为可维护、可协作、可扩展的智力成果。真正的编程高手,不靠炫技,而靠对细节的敬畏与对本质的洞察。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

